Then, eight years after his arrival, his beloved younger sister, Susan, who had been a diabetic since she was twelve, got sick. Shelby was based on Robert Harling's real sister, Susan Harling Robinson, who passed away from complications due to her type 1 diabetes. Less than a year into the plays run, the legendary producer Ray Stark bought the film rights, and in 1988 it was made into a movie starring Sally Field and Julia Roberts as the mother/daughter characters, MLynn and Shelby. Harling's work, with elements of tragedy and comedy, was inspired by the playwright's hometown of Natchitoches and the death of his sister, Susan Harling Robinson, in 1985 due to complications from diabetes.
